On this episode of Faith Boost, Pastor Andrew McLennan talks about how to call upon the name of the Lord when everything seems to go wrong. Especially during times of grief and loss. Andrew starts off by sharing the story of Adam and Eve. They were made in God’s image and lived in a perfect paradise until they disobeyed Him.
This led to many struggles, and eventually Adam and Eve were sent away from the Garden of Eden. This moment changed everything, bringing hardship and sadness into their lives. ‘Life takes on a really new slant for Adam and Eve,’ says Andrew. ‘Everything’s changed. Everything’s hard. The Bible says even the ground became hard. It was hard to produce fruit and vegetables. Adam had to work extra hard.’
But then things take a heartbreaking turn when their son Cain tragically kills his brother Abel. The depth of sorrow Adam and Eve must have experienced is unimaginable. It’s a pain no parent should ever endure. Yet, despite their profound loss and the temptation to despair, they held onto God’s instruction to be fruitful and multiply (Genesis 1:28).
This command became their guiding light and a source of hope amidst the darkness. ‘I’m sure Adam and Eve longed for the old days,’ says Andrew. ‘But you know what they did instead? They went back to what God had said to them in the beginning.’
Call Upon the Name of the Lord
In the wake of their losses, Adam and Eve chose to focus on obeying God. They took intentional steps to fulfill His command, which led to the birth of their son Seth. Andrew beleives this was a pivotal new beginning. Through Seth’s lineage, people began to call upon the name of the Lord once more. This act of faith not only marked a turning point for Adam and Eve but also sparked a spiritual renewal for many.
‘A move in God happened in the midst of that darkness,’ says Andrew. ‘It happened in the midst of the sadness and the tragedy of their grief and loss. They went back to the Word of God and they saw God move again. It didn’t take away the pain of their loss. But sometimes you’ve just go to realise, I’ve only got a certain amount of time to do something for God.’
Andrew connects this to our lives today, encouraging us to keep going after facing loss, just like Adam and Eve did. He reminds us to focus on what God has called us to do, even when things are hard. Andrew encourages us to trust God’s promises and keep moving forward, no matter how tough life gets.
‘We’ve got to stand up again,’ says Andrew. ‘We’ve got to say, what did God call me to do? Adam and Eve did that and the world got better. Men began to call on the Lord again.’
‘We can all pick ourselves up. And we all can go again.’
